1 Fourth Quarter and Full Year 2015 FUND COMMENTARY FOR PURCHASE BY ACCREDITED INVESTORS ONLY Fourth Quarter and Full Year 2015 Review: Blackstone Alternative Alpha Fund (BAAF) i The Blackstone Alternative Alpha Fund (BAAF) returned 0.60% net of fees in the fourth quarter vs % for the S&P 500 and +5.62% for the MSCI World Equity index. For the 2015 calendar year, BAAF was down 2.69% versus +1.38% for the S&P 500 and 0.32% for the MSCI World. Blackstone Alternative Alpha Fund 2015 in Review 2015 was a challenging year for the equity markets and for hedge funds generally. BAAF returns trailed global equity markets for 2015 as a whole. With that said, the goal of the BAAF Fund is to provide investors with a less volatile way of investing in equity markets and to deliver performance driven by alpha. Since inception in April 2012, BAAF s net performance has captured 39% of the S&P 500 market upside, and just 39% downside capture in negative months. As volatility climbed from August on, returning to its historical average of about 20%, BAAF remained in line with its sinceinception standard deviation of 5.2%. (display below, left). BAAF has two primary levers to adjust the amount of equity exposure in the portfolio. One is to adjust the allocation to equity oriented versus diversifying strategies. Historically, the breakdown within BAAF has been approximately 75% to equity long/short strategies and 25% to diversifying strategies. Given BAAM s top down views throughout 2015 that equity markets were richly valued, we have been reducing exposure to managers with higher market directionality. In 2015, exposure to equity managers fell to 70% down from 78% at the beginning of the year (display below, right), while allocations to diversifying strategies have increased to 27% up from 24%. ii Equity Market Volatility Rose from Summer 2015 BAAF Equity Allocation Falls Over Course of 2015 Standard Devilation 20% 15% 10% 5% 0% S&P 500 versus BAAF T12M Standard Deviation Allocation to Equity Oriented Managers 80% 76% 72% 68% BAAF Allocation to Equity Oriented Managers BAAF Net S&P 500 TR Index BAAF Total Equities Allocation Source: Bloomberg, Blackstone. The other lever is to rebalance within the equity bucket, allocating among fundamental equity, equity activist and equity trading strategies. Over the course of the year, allocations to equity activist managers fell to 14% from a high of 22%. This was the single largest adjustment in the portfolio, as these managers tend to run with higher market directionality and higher beta and we believe many activist names have become increasingly crowded. 2 Fourth Quarter and Full Year 2015 FUND COMMENTARY FOR PURCHASE BY ACCREDITED INVESTORS ONLY 2015 Contributors and Detractors 2015 can be characterized as a tale of two halves. During the first half of 2015, BAAF was up +2.96% net (January June), driven by equity fundamental and equity activist managers with outsized exposure to financials and healthcare. But in the latter half of the year, the Fund was down 5.49% (July December), with the largest headwinds coming from activist managers as well as fundamental managers with exposure to the healthcare sector (particularly pharma) and energy names. Looking at the year in aggregate, equity fundamental strategies contributed the majority of performance, followed by quantitative strategies. Several equity managers benefitted from meaningful exposures to the FANG (Facebook, Amazon, Netflix, and Google) stocks and high growth tech weights. Quantitative strategies benefitted from short positions in biotech and energies. The largest detractor was our equity activist strategies. There were no positive contributing activist managers in 2015, with managers suffering from positions in pharma, energy, and consumer names. New Managers Added & Removed During the course of this year we added several new funds to the portfolio including MTP Energy, Autonomy Global Macro, and Third Point. Magnetar MTP Energy seeks to offer low beta exposure to the North American energy market and the shale revolution through an experienced team with the backing of Magnetar s risk management system. The Autonomy Global Macro Fund is a discretionary macro fund that opportunistically invests across both developed and emerging markets with a value bias. The manager focuses primarily on liquid assets in FX, rates, credit, and equities. Investments are driven by a robust research process that focuses on fundamental asset value and macroeconomic policy. Third Point pursues an opportunistic, value oriented, event driven strategy across the capital structure, investing in equities, corporate credit, structured credit, and risk arbitrage. The Fund seeks to identify companies or other securities/investments for which the team anticipates a catalyst that will unlock value. Third Point pursues a similar approach to creating short positions, looking for distress that may lead to a significant negative revaluation. Third Point will invest across different geographies, industries, and security types. We redeemed from BlueTrend this year given our belief that the added value from CTAs has declined in recent periods. Recent indicators of sophistication in the trend space have been less about refinements in the pure trend models and more about the portfolio wide diversification of this type of exposure through the inclusion of negatively correlated or uncorrelated non trend models, some of which rely on fundamental data sources. Outlook for 2016 We expect to continue to assess and judiciously increase allocations to diversifying strategies, including macro focused strategies that have the potential to capitalize on trends in foreign exchange rates, interest rates and cross border relative value trades. We also expect to increase allocations to trading oriented managers that may be able to capitalize on market volatility and reduce our allocation to activist managers that tend to have more directional exposure. 6 Glossary of Terms BAAF December 31, 2015 Hedge Fund Strategies Equities Fundamental: Managers that primarily invest in equities and equity derivatives based on in depth bottom up analysis, which may be driven top down market views Fundamental managers tend to have higher net exposure than trading managers. Equities Trading: Managers that primarily invest in equities and equity derivatives based on in depth bottom up analysis, which may be driven top down market views. Trading managers tend to have lower net exposure to broad market moves than Fundamental managers. Equities Activist: Managers that invest, primarily through equity securities, in companies with the intention to take an active role in unlocking value through corporate restructuring and management improvements. Multi Strategy: Includes managers that invest across multiple strategies. Typical strategies found in a multi strategy manager include convertible arbitrage, long / short equities, credit fundamental hedged, fixed income arbitrage, quantitative equity strategies, and volatility arbitrage. Macro Rates: Inter country strategies focused primarily on relative value investments on interest rates and currency markets. Macro Thematic: Discretionary, directional, and inter country exposure to interest rates, FX, equities and commodities. Quantitative Strategies: This strategy combines technically driven statistical arbitrage with fundamental quantitative long/short strategies employing model driven research to identify investment opportunities. Investment Terms Beta: A measure of the volatility, or systematic risk, of a security or a portfolio in comparison to the market as a whole. Alpha: A measure of performance on a risk adjusted basis. Alpha compares risk adjusted performance to a benchmark index. The excess return of the fund relative to the return of the benchmark index is a fund s alpha. Gross Exposure: Reflects the aggregate of long and short investment positions in relation to the net asset value. For example, if the fund is 60% long and 50% short, then the fund is 110% gross invested. The gross exposure is one indication of the level of leverage in a portfolio. Long: A long position occurs when an individual (or hedge fund) owns securities. Net Exposure: This is the difference between long and short investment positions in relation to the net asset value. For example if the fund is 60% long and 50% short, then the fund is 10% net invested. Sharpe Ratio: A ratio to measure risk adjusted performance. The Sharpe ratio is calculated by subtracting the risk free rate such as that of the 90 DayU.S.TreasuryBillfrom the rate of return for a portfolio and dividing the result by the standard deviation of the portfolio returns. The greater a portfolio's Sharpe ratio, the better its riskadjusted performance has been. Short: Short selling a security not actually owned at the time of sale. Short positions can also generate returns directly when the price of a security declines. Volatility: A statistical measure of the dispersion of returns for a given security or market index. Volatility can either be measured by using the standard deviation or variance between returns from that same security or market index. Commonly, the higher the volatility, the riskier the security. HFRI Equity Hedge: is an unmanaged equal weighted index representing hedge funds tracked by Hedge Fund Research, Inc. that have an equity hedge strategy. Equity hedge strategies invest in both long and short positions in primarily equity and equity derivative securities. A wide variety of investment processes can be employed to arrive at an investment decision, including both quantitative and fundamental techniques; strategies can be broadly diversified or narrowly focused on specific sectors and can range broadly in terms of levels of net exposure, leverage employed, holding period, concentrations of market capitalizations and valuation ranges of typical portfolios. The Index is revised several times each month to reflect updated hedge fund return information. The Index is a proxy for the performance of the universe of funds of hedge funds focused on equity hedged strategies. There are no asset size or track record length minimum requirements for inclusion in the Index. The Index reflects actual fees and expenses charged by the hedge funds included in the Index. Note: While the HFRI Indices are frequently used, they have limitations (some of which are typical of other widely used indices). These limitations include survivorship bias (the returns of the indices may not be representative of all the hedge funds in the universe because of the tendency of lower performing funds to leave the index); heterogeneity (not all hedge funds are alike or comparable to one another, and the index may not accurately reflect the performance of a described style); and limited data (many hedge funds do not report to indices, and, therefore, the index may omit funds, the inclusion of which might significantly affect the performance shown. The HFRI Indices are based on information self reported by hedge fund managers that decide on their own, at any time, whether or not they want to provide, or continue to provide, information to HFR Asset Management, L.L.C. Results for funds that go out of business are included in the index until the date that they cease operations. Therefore, these indices may not be complete or accurate representations of the hedge fund universe, and may be biased in several ways.
